The technique I used on this card is called “paper piecing”. I stamped the images on the Retro Fresh Designer Series Paper and then cut them out and layered them.
Paper Piecing Technique with the Life in the Forest Stamp Set:
Supplies:
Life in the Forest stamp set ($20.95 wood, $15.95 clear)
Retro Fresh Designer Series Paper
Baked Brown Sugar, Coastal Cabana, So Saffron Card Stock
Countless Sayings 2 Photopolymer stamp set
